Based on life history interviews with 138 low-income fathers, Black and Keyes show that fathers have internalized these messages and sound determined.

In It's a Setup, Timothy Black and Sky Keyes ground a moving and intimate narrative in the political and economic circumstances that shape the lives of low-income fathers.
